Coral reefs are a vital part of an ecosystem. They represent the
skeletons of algae and corals solidified into calcium carbonate. There
are several different types of reef, including apron, fringing and
table, depending on their relationship to the shore. In terms of the
ecosystem, coral reefs support a huge amount of sea life by recycling
nutrients in nutrient-low parts of the ocean, therefore providing life
and health for the surrounding sea life, while also feeding off it to
produce new reef formations. They also represent homes for various
types of tropical fish, and other sea organisms, such as lobsters and
sea turtles. Pollution and the live food fish have developed into
serious threats to the delicate ecosystem balance that the coral reef
